Gwendolyn Bounds

Gwendolyn Bounds is an award-winning journalist, author and speaker, most recently working at The Wall Street Journal Leadership Institute where she is Senior Vice President & Head of Content. Her first book, Little Chapel on the River, earned wide acclaim for its poignant portrayal of life inside a small-town pub after the terrorist attacks of September 11, 2001. Bounds’ career spans influential media brands including ABC News, Consumer Reports, CNBC, SmartNews, and two decades as a reporter & editor at The Wall Street Journal. Raised in North Carolina, Bounds now lives in New York’s Hudson River Valley.
